Abstract
Abstract. This paper describes our research interests and technical information of our team for RoboCup-99. Our robots have been developed to have a capability of a pass-based tactics. That is, the capability of receiving a ball from any direction and passing the ball to a desired robot. To achieve the capability, our robots have omnidirectional moving mechanisms and kicking devices. 1
